What is dexrabeprazole sodium and domperidone capsules used for?

Pharmaceutical Product Monograph: Dexrabeprazole Sodium + Domperidone Capsules

In the pharmaceutical industry, this combination represents a Chiral PPI + Dopamine Antagonist therapy. As a pharmacist and manufacturer, I classify this as a “High-Efficiency Reflux Solution”—it is technically designed for patients who suffer from GERD (Gastroesophageal Reflux Disease) and Dyspepsia where acid suppression and stomach-clearing are both required.

At your WHO-GMP facility in Mumbai, this FDC (Fixed-Dose Combination) is a core Gastroenterology SKU. It is the “refined” successor to the standard Rabeprazole + Domperidone combinations, offering a “cleaner” pharmacological profile.


Therapeutic Profile: Primary Indications

This combination is indicated for the management of acid-peptic disorders associated with impaired gastric motility.

IndicationClinical ContextTechnical Rationale
GERD (Acid Reflux)HeartburnStops the “backwash” of acid into the esophagus and prevents mucosal damage.
Non-Ulcer DyspepsiaIndigestionRelieves the “heaviness” and bloating felt in the upper stomach after eating.
Peptic UlcersGastric/DuodenalProvides a pH-neutral environment to allow the stomach lining to heal.
LPR (Silent Reflux)ENT / ThroatReduces acid vapor that causes chronic cough or throat irritation.

Mechanism: The “Active-Isomer” Advantage

This combination works through two distinct chemical pathways to manage “Stomach Traffic”:

  1. Dexrabeprazole (The S-Enantiomer): This is the active “half” of Rabeprazole. Technically, regular Rabeprazole is a 50/50 mix of mirror-image molecules. By using only the S-isomer, 10 mg of Dexrabeprazole is as potent as 20 mg of regular Rabeprazole. It inhibits the $H^+/K^+\text{-ATPase}$ (Proton Pump) more efficiently, with less metabolic stress on the liver.

  2. Domperidone (The Prokinetic): This is a peripheral dopamine ($D_2$) receptor antagonist. It technically increases the pressure of the Lower Esophageal Sphincter (LES)—the “valve” at the top of the stomach—while stimulating the stomach to empty its contents into the intestine faster.

  3. The Result: Dexrabeprazole turns off the “acid tap,” while Domperidone ensures the stomach is empty, physically preventing reflux from occurring.


The Pharmacist’s “Technical Warning”

  • The “30-Minute” Protocol: This capsule must be taken on an empty stomach, ideally 30 minutes before breakfast. This allows the Domperidone to start moving the gut before the first meal of the day arrives.

  • Cardiac Precaution: While safe for most, Domperidone carries a technical risk of QT Prolongation (irregular heart rhythm) at high doses or in elderly patients.

  • The “Chiral” Benefit: Patients often report fewer headaches and less “brain fog” on Dexrabeprazole compared to older PPIs, as the body isn’t processing the inactive R-isomer.

  • Drug Interactions: Avoid taking with Ketoconazole or Erythromycin, as these can dangerously increase the blood levels of Domperidone.

What is Dexrabeprazole Sodium & Cinitapride Capsules used For ?

Pharmaceutical Product Monograph: Dexrabeprazole Sodium + Cinitapride Capsules

In the pharmaceutical industry, this combination represents a high-tier Chiral PPI + Third-Generation Prokinetic therapy. As a pharmacist and manufacturer, I classify this as a “Superior Motility Solution”—it is technically designed for patients with Refractory GERD (reflux that doesn’t respond to standard meds) and Functional Dyspepsia.

At your WHO-GMP facility in Mumbai, this FDC (Fixed-Dose Combination) is a specialized Gastroenterology SKU that offers significant advantages over older combinations like Rabeprazole + Domperidone.


Therapeutic Profile: Primary Indications

This combination is indicated for the treatment of gastrointestinal disorders where both acid suppression and enhanced movement (motility) are required.

IndicationClinical ContextTechnical Rationale
Non-Erosive Reflux (NERD)Acid RefluxTreats patients who have classic heartburn symptoms but no visible damage on endoscopy.
Functional DyspepsiaIndigestionRelieves the “early fullness,” bloating, and upper abdominal heaviness after meals.
Delayed Gastric EmptyingMotility DisorderSpecifically targets the stomach’s inability to move food into the small intestine efficiently.
Chronic GastritisInflammationReduces acid irritation while preventing the “backwash” of bile into the stomach.

Mechanism: The “Chiral & Prokinetic” Synergy

This combination works through two highly sophisticated chemical pathways:

  1. Dexrabeprazole (The S-Isomer PPI): As we discussed, this is the “active half” of Rabeprazole. It technically blocks the $H^+/K^+\text{-ATPase}$ pump (the proton pump) in the stomach. Because it is a chiral molecule, 10 mg of Dexrabeprazole is as effective as 20 mg of regular Rabeprazole, providing potent acid control with a lower chemical load on the liver.

  2. Cinitapride (The 5-HT Receptor Modulator): Unlike Domperidone (which is a dopamine antagonist), Cinitapride is a 5-HT4 agonist and 5-HT2 antagonist. It technically stimulates the release of acetylcholine in the gut, which significantly speeds up gastric emptying and improves the coordination of the digestive tract.

  3. The Result: Dexrabeprazole stops the “acid fire,” while Cinitapride ensures the “stomach traffic” moves in the right direction (downward), preventing reflux from happening in the first place.


The Pharmacist’s “Technical Warning”

  • The “30-Minute” Rule: To work effectively, this capsule must be taken on an empty stomach, ideally 30 minutes before breakfast. This gives the Cinitapride time to activate the gut’s motility before food arrives.

  • Safety over Domperidone: One major technical benefit of Cinitapride is that it has a lower risk of cardiac side effects (QT prolongation) and hormonal issues (prolactin increase) compared to Domperidone.

  • Avoid Alcohol: Alcohol can increase gastric irritation and counteract the prokinetic effect of Cinitapride.

  • Neurological Monitoring: While rare, Cinitapride can occasionally cause minor tremors or “extrapyramidal symptoms” in very sensitive patients.
